Pressure-Cooked Salsa Verde Pork and Rice

Effortlessly prep salsa verde pork and brown rice together using the Pot-in-Pot method for efficient weekly meals.
Ingredients:
  • 2 pounds boneless pork shoulder roast, trimmed of excess fat and c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 0.5 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 0.25 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1.5 cups brown rice, rinsed well
  • 1 teaspoon olive oil
  • 1.75 cups water
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 (16 ounce) jar salsa verde (such as Herdez®)
  • 0.25 cup chopped cilantro
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 6 (3-cup) storage containers
Instructions:
  • In a medium bowl, combine pork cubes with oregano, cumin, salt, coriander, and pepper, ensuring all meat is evenly coated.
  • Rinse rice thoroughly under cold running water using a fine mesh strainer until water runs clear. Drain well.
  • Drizzle 1 teaspoon of oil into an oven-safe bowl that fits inside your pressure cooker. Combine rice, salt, and 1 3/4 cups plus 1 tablespoon water in the bowl. Set aside.
  • In the electric pressure cooker set to Saute mode on high heat, heat 2 tablespoons of oil. Brown pork in batches until lightly browned, about 5 to 6 minutes each. Turn off the cooker, then stir in salsa verde until well combined.
  • In the pressure cooker, position a tall trivet for the rice to rest above the pork. Put the bowl of uncooked rice on the trivet, seal the lid, and set the valve to 'Seal.' Choose high pressure as directed by the manufacturer; cook for 24 minutes. Wait for 10 to 15 minutes for the pressure to rise.
  • Allow the pressure to naturally release for 10 to 40 minutes following the manufacturer's guidelines.
  • Unlock and lift off the lid. Using oven mitts, carefully take out the bowl of rice. Allow it to cool for a bit, then mix in fresh cilantro and a squeeze of zesty lime juice.
  • 1. Preheat the pressure cooker to Saute mode on medium heat. Simmer the sauce until desired thickness, about 8 to 10 minutes. Portion rice into 6 storage containers and top with pork and sauce. Chill until serving.
